PRODUCT DETAILS:
Robotics: Smart Machines - Tracks & Treads
The latest installment in the award-winning Robotics: Smart Machines line, this version focuses on motorized machines that make use of continuous tracks, also known as tank treads, to move themselves and other objects around. Models are controlled by programs and an ultrasound sensor, so in addition to constructing the machines, you’ll also learn how to use the included visual programming app on your tablet or smartphone to code the programs yourself. Build a robot with two large continuous tracks that drives around and avoids obstacles in its path. The attentive tracker bot model detects your hand, moves toward it, and follows it around. Construct models of real-world smart machines, like a conveyor belt robot that carries small objects and an escalator model that carries objects up to another level. You can also assemble other fun robots including a dozer bot with a bulldozer attachment on its front end and a fire rescue robot that drives its ladder up close to other objects. Once you understand how the technology works, you can build your own robots using the kit’s 197 building pieces and create your own programs in the programming app, which is available on iOS and Android devices (tablet or smartphone required, not included).
Meet Sammy. This cute little peanut butter and jelly sandwich is actually a robot that teaches coding principles and skills to children in grades K-2. You don’t need a tablet, smartphone, or computer to program this robot; programs are created by simply laying down a sequence of physical code cards. As the robot drives over the code cards, an OID optical scanner on the bottom of the robot reads the code cards one by one and loads the program. Next, place the robot on a grid made of map cards, and the robot runs the program. You can program the robot to move in different directions, activate its output gear, light up its LED, play sounds, and respond to different function cards. The integrated output gear makes it possible to build simple robotic creations with arms or other moving parts that respond according to the program’s instructions.
This robot kit also teaches physical engineering and problem solving skills through a series of building and coding lessons. The 30 lessons are aligned with standards for computer science education developed by the Computer Science Teachers Association (CSTA) and the International Society for Technology (ISTE) Education, as well as courses from Code.org. The lessons progress in complexity through the illustrated manual, allowing the kit to be appropriate for a child as young as four years with help from an adult and as old as eight years. The lessons cover these six key areas in coding: sequencing, loops, events, conditionals, functions, and variables.
In addition to Sammy, there are five other stories, each with a series of model-building and coding challenges and lessons related to it: a mouse moves through a maze to find cheese; a penguin wanders around a zoo; a soccer player moves a ball into the goal; a fire truck puts out a fire; and a factory robot performs tasks in a factory scene. A full-color illustrated manual guides users through the coding lessons and the assembly of the different models.
